#1176d2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1176d2 is composed of 6.7% red, 46.3% green and 82.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 91.9% cyan, 43.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 17.6% black. It has a hue angle of 208.6 degrees, a saturation of 85% and a lightness of 44.5%. #1176d2 color hex could be obtained by blending #22ecff with #0000a5. Closest websafe color is: #0066cc.

Shades and Tints of #1176d2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#01060a is the darkest color, while #f7fbf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1176d2

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#717272 is the less saturated color, while #0876db is the most saturated one.
